Leveled ground,
He makes the very land sturdy and straight,
Drenching and molding it with grace,
We can trust the rock that He placed,
The rejected cornerstone,
That smooths out and shatters walls,
That we can stomp on and feel His integrity,
That we can fall on and know He won't go away,
That we can kneel on and know His security and faithfulness,
His grace paves the narrow way and calls us to cast down our shackles of sin,
For they cling to our wrists in bits and we must cast them down with determined shakes.
